Abstract

Malus hupenensis var. `Pingyitiancha' is an important apple stock with many good characteristics, including waterloggig resistance, cold resistance, salt resistance and so on. The three group gene-HVA1 come from barley was transformed into `Pingyitiancha' mediated by Agrobacterium tumefaciens and transformed regeneration plants were obtained in this research. The HAV1 gene cloned from plasmid containing it (offered by Dr. Guo Weidong) by PCR with high fidelity pfu Taq DNA polymerase. It was ligated between BamH 1 and Sac 1 site in PUC118 vector, and identified by electrophoresis after digested with BamH 1 and Sac 1. Through nuclear sequence detecting, it is confirmed that the HAV1 gene cloned in this research is 703bp.This fragment was ligated with 11kb fragment from pB121 plasmid and constructed pBHA vetor. The pBHA vector was introduced in A.tum LBA4404 by triparental mating and the binary vector was obtained. It is cinfirmed that HVA1 gene had been insert in T-DNA by in situ hybirdization. Using `Pingyitiancha' shoot apex, mediated by A. tum. System, the HAV 1 gene was transformed into the plant. Kam resistance regeneration plants were obtained, 6 of them were confirmed as transformation plants by PCR and dot blot.
